What Are Biscuits and Gravy?
At the heart of Biscuits and Gravy lies the simple yet indulgent combination of two key ingredients: freshly baked biscuits and a creamy sausage gravy. The biscuits, typically made with flour, butter, milk, and a leavening agent like baking powder, are soft, flaky, and golden brown. These are served with a savory gravy that often features ground sausage, milk, flour, and seasonings like black pepper and sage. The result is a dish that’s not only filling but also incredibly satisfying and comforting.
The Origins of Biscuits and Gravy
Though the exact origins of Biscuits and Gravy are debated, it is widely believed to have deep roots in the Southern United States. During the 19th century, biscuits were a staple food for many families due to their simplicity and affordability. Gravy, often made with the drippings from meat, was added to provide flavor and make the dish more filling. As the dish evolved, sausage became a common addition, and Biscuits and Gravy became a beloved breakfast tradition.

The Sausage Gravy: The Star of the Dish
The key to Biscuits and Gravy lies in the sausage gravy. To make the gravy, ground sausage is cooked until it releases its fat, and then flour is added to create a roux. Milk is slowly incorporated into the mixture, creating a smooth, creamy consistency. Seasoned with salt, pepper, and sometimes herbs like sage or thyme, this gravy has a rich, savory flavor that pairs perfectly with the biscuits. The gravy can be made mild or spicy, depending on the type of sausage used, allowing for a customizable experience for different taste preferences.

The Southern Classic
The traditional Southern version of Biscuits and Gravy features a simple, no-frills approach. The focus is on the texture and flavor of the biscuits, paired with a hearty sausage gravy. Southern cooks often use pork sausage, which adds a robust and savory flavor to the gravy. The gravy is seasoned with just enough salt and pepper to enhance the taste without overpowering the richness of the sausage.

Country Style Biscuits and Gravy
In the rural parts of the South, Country Style Biscuits and Gravy is a popular variation. This version uses a chunkier sausage gravy, with larger pieces of sausage and sometimes even crumbled bacon. The biscuits are often made with buttermilk, giving them a tangy flavor that complements the rich, meaty gravy. This version is perfect for those who enjoy a heartier, more rustic take on the dish.
Vegetarian Biscuits and Gravy
For those who prefer a meatless version, Vegetarian Biscuits and Gravy has become increasingly popular. Instead of sausage, the gravy is made with plant-based sausage or vegetables like mushrooms, which add depth and texture. The gravy is just as creamy and savory as the traditional version, but without the meat, making it a great option for vegetarians or those looking to cut back on animal products.

Spicy Biscuits and Gravy
If you like a little heat, you might enjoy Spicy Biscuits and Gravy. This variation adds a kick by incorporating spicy sausage, hot sauce, or crushed red pepper flakes into the gravy. The result is a flavorful, fiery version of the classic dish that’s perfect for those who love bold, spicy flavors.
Tips for Making the Perfect Biscuits and Gravy
While making Biscuits and Gravy might seem simple, there are a few tips that can take your dish to the next level. Whether you’re making it at home or enjoying it at a local diner, here are some key tips to ensure your biscuits and gravy come out perfectly every time.
1. Use Cold Butter for Flaky Biscuits
For the fluffiest, flakiest biscuits, it’s essential to use cold butter. When mixed into the flour, cold butter creates pockets of air, which helps the biscuits rise and become light and airy. Be sure to work quickly when making the biscuit dough to prevent the butter from warming up too much.

2. Don’t Skimp on Seasoning
The gravy may be creamy, but it’s the seasoning that gives it its depth of flavor. Be generous with salt, pepper, and any additional spices you enjoy. Fresh herbs, like thyme or sage, can add a delightful aromatic touch to the gravy. Don’t forget to taste the gravy as you go to ensure it’s well-seasoned.
3. Use a Cast Iron Skillet
Cooking the sausage and making the gravy in a cast iron skillet is ideal for achieving the perfect texture. The skillet retains heat well, which ensures that the sausage cooks evenly and the gravy thickens to the right consistency.

4. Serve Immediately
Biscuits and Gravy is best enjoyed fresh and hot. The biscuits should be warm and the gravy should be thick and creamy. If you need to prepare the dish ahead of time, keep the biscuits and gravy separate and reheat them just before serving.
